England, 1106 A.D. Norman rule lies heavily on the land. When a Norman earl is killed while hunting, the dead earl's son invokes the dreaded murdrum law. This law presumes that the killer is English. It requires the judicial district in which the crime took place to produce the guilty man or be hit with a massive fine.
